Singapore Airlines has asked its 6,600 cabin crew members to take seven days unpaid leave every two months until the end of March 2004.

Analysts estimate the plan will save the airline Singapore$100m ($56.5m; £35.4m) if cabin crew accept it. SIA are negotiating a similar deal over unpaid leave with its pilots

Singapore Airlines has already cut 30% of its capacity, or about 199 flights a week.
